Information - Never Mind The Stigma: A Tonic Music Workshop

Part of the Brighten the Corners Talks

Tonic Music presents Never Mind The Stigma, a workshop exploring the benefits of listening to music for our mental health – from playing records to attending festivals. Facilitated by Jeordie Shenton (Programmes Lead at Tonic Music), participants are encouraged to take part in this informal, open discussion. Tonic Music is a registered charity with the aim of establishing good mental health within music communities, including providing mental health support for music fans as part of the Never Mind The Stigma programme.
